Name: John Templar
Central High
Hernando
2015
OLB 6-1/210
What do we have here? What jumps off the screen is Templar’s instinct and motor. The young man gets after it from the backside, holds his ground on the play side and uses his hands very well when leveraging blockers. Looks to have a nice frame on film and moves pretty well in space. I love the way he plays close to the line of scrimmage; Very confortable in the trenchers and wants to give blows and not take them.

John Brunner
Clearwater Central Catholic
Pinellas
2015
WR/TE 6-2.5/175
Not the guy who will hog the Sports Center Top 10 highlights weekly. But the guy which will catch the football anywhere close to him. On his film, he made several catches that would require a high level of concentration. He runs well and can separate from defenders. Does a really good job using his length to make difficult receptions.

Felipe Fernandez
Plant
Hillsborough
2016
OT 6-5/273
I think we got one here. Each year the Panthers graduate one or two really good or stud offensive linemen. The area of town produces some big boys (It must be in the Bayshore water). Fernandez looks to be another product that has a chance to flourish in the next few years. Big body prospect that could possibly play any position on the offensive line. I love his flexibility and his hand placement.

Shawn O’Gorman
Weeki Wachee
Hernando
2016
RB/SWR 5-8/170
O’Gorman will likely have a bunch of yards this year. Just from the spring game, he played several different positions and his offensive coordinator used him in several different ways in order to get the ball in his hands. Tough runner, quick, a little elusive, but a really good player!

Daniel Jones
Santa Fe Catholic
Polk
2015
RB/WR/DB 5-8/155
Hits the hole fast! Always a good thing for an offensive line, means they will not have to hold their blocks as long. Jones has some sweet feet. Not the fastest RB in the county. But, his footwork gives him more opportunities to evade tacklers and gain more rush yards on the ground.
